The plan is part of the company's Debug initiative, a decade-old program that intends to reduce diseases spread by mosquitoes ...
The program seeks approval to release millions of non-biting male mosquitoes to reduce the spread of diseases ...
An earlier project already led to a 95 percent drop in biting females of one disease-carrying species in Fresno.
